1. Define the Clinton geography before judging a source
Clinton is recorded as a census-designated place in Maryland, with a recorded relationship to Prince George's County. The 2020–2024 ACS five-year population estimate for Clinton CDP is 38,376, with a margin of error of 1,577. That is geographic and population context—not evidence of legal demand, search volume, competition, case volume or revenue. Attribution should therefore distinguish the geography a visitor reached from the geography your firm actually serves. A visit to a Clinton page, a referral from elsewhere in Prince George's County and a matter from another Maryland community should not automatically be treated as the same local opportunity.
Recommended approach
At consultation, decide which geographic labels matter in your records: Clinton, Prince George's County, broader Maryland service areas or another defined territory. Then review whether landing-page and referral information can be interpreted alongside your intake and matter records without treating population as a forecast.
